    Abstract: A tire failure detection device includes a steering angle sensor for sensing a steering angle, a yaw rate sensor for sensing a yaw rate, and a control unit. The control unit calculates side-slip energy based on the output signal of the steering angle sensor and the output signal of the yaw rate sensor, and determines that a failure has occurred in a tire when the side-slip energy exceeds a first threshold.

    Abstract: A heavy-duty vehicle has a first set of metallic brakes and a second set of non-metallic brakes having lower weight than the metallic brakes. A processor device is configured to acquire prediction data indicative of an upcoming brake event that is expected to occur along a road on which the vehicle is travelling; determine, based on the prediction data, an expected value of kinetic energy that will be absorbed during said upcoming brake event; select, based on said determined expected value of kinetic energy, which one of the first and second sets of brakes that is to be activated to absorb kinetic energy during said upcoming brake event; and control the selected set of brakes to be activated during said brake event, wherein the other set of brakes remains inactivated during said brake event.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a device for installing traction batteries underneath a cab of a cab-over-engine vehicle. A base portion defines a space into which a portion of a traction battery pack is receivable by lowering the traction battery pack into said space. Front and rear securing element are connected to the base portion for securing the base portion to front and rear bushings, respectively, of the vehicle. At least one of the securing elements comprises a first securing portion for connecting that securing element to one of said bushings, respectively, and a second securing portion projecting upwardly from the base portion for connecting that securing element to the traction battery pack when the traction battery pack has been received in said space.

    Abstract: A computer-implemented method is provided for controlling a vehicle driveline comprising a propulsion unit and a transmission. The method uses topographic data in order to provide predictive control of the vehicle driveline, where the driveline comprises a first driving mode and a second driving mode, where the vehicle is driving to a predetermined destination. The method includes receiving topographic data for the route to the predetermined destination, determining a number of predictive parameters for the route, where, in the first driving mode, the vehicle driveline is controlled in an eco-mode in order to provide the lowest possible energy consumption to the predetermined destination, and where, in the second driving mode, the vehicle driveline is controlled in order for the vehicle to arrive at the predetermined destination at a predetermined time.

    Abstract: A method performed by a control unit in connection with a pre-heating process of an aftertreatment system for a combustion engine is provided. The control unit obtains a scheduled start time of the combustion engine. The control unit schedules a pre-heating of the aftertreatment system to be completed before the scheduled start time. The control unit detects a start of the combustion engine at an actual start time. In response to the detected start of the combustion engine, and using the actual and scheduled start times, the control unit determines whether the scheduled pre-heating of the aftertreatment system fulfils one or more success criteria. When the one or more success criteria are fulfilled, the control unit triggers a performance increase of the combustion engine.
